Alert: InkcheckLinterBacklog. This fires when the Inkcheck documentation linter's queue exceeds 500 pending pages for more than thirty minutes, which usually means authors will see stale validation results and may publish unchecked content. Support should reassure reporters that publishing still works, then escalate to the tooling rotation. Triage steps and current queue status are on the page below.

operations page: https://jenkins.zemvarcloud.local/job/merge_requests/repo/build/73930b4b30f0a8ed

## Cleaning-Crew Access — Halden Wing

Brightmoor Cleaning staff attend weekday evenings from 18:30. Team assistants should ensure meeting rooms are unlocked and desks cleared beforehand. The crew enters via the rear service corridor; the supervisor signs the register at the Halden Wing desk. The service-corridor keypad accepts the code below.

turnstile pass: bdg-FVNQRS-72965873

Meeting notes — Calcbridge sync, Tuesday. We reviewed how user-supplied formulas in Tallygrove sheets are evaluated inside the sandbox. Key point for support: formulas referencing external cells now fail closed with error SBX-DENIED rather than returning blanks. Please do not advise customers to disable the sandbox flag under any circumstances. Escalations on sandbox behavior should go to the person named below.

approver of tagef-hawef = Oliok Julath

## Environments: Firmware Update Channel

Quick overview for the review: the Lumabit firmware channel has three rings — canary, beta, and stable. Devices poll the Ashfall relay hourly, and payloads are signed before staging. Canary pulls straight from CI, which is the bit worth scrutinizing; everything else goes through a manual promotion gate. For reference while you audit, the current channel configuration for each ring is shown below.

config for kafof-bawef:
holath:
  log_level: debug
  metrics_host: metrics.holath.qorvelsys.internal
  pin: 2191
  pool_size: 32